Mangles kangaroo paw and Celery Physical Information

Mangles kangaroo paw and Celery physical information is very important for comparison. Mangles kangaroo paw height is 30.00 cm and width 40.60 cm whereas Celery height is 45.70 cm and width 30.50 cm. The color specification of Mangles kangaroo paw and Celery are as follows:

  • Mangles kangaroo paw flower color: Red and Green

  • Mangles kangaroo paw leaf color: Dark Green

  • Celery flower color: White

  • Celery leaf color: Light Green
